Jeffery To d85c355aa1 treewide: use relative include paths for python Makefiles
This updates the include paths for python(3)-package.mk to be relative
to the package Makefile. If not, in certain cases this will print errors
like the following one:

ERROR: please fix feeds/openwrt/net/freeradius3/Makefile
   - see logs/feeds/openwrt/net/freeradius3/dump.txt for details

In the dump.txt there is the following:

Makefile:42: /mylocalpath/feeds/packages/lang/python/python3-package.mk: No such file or directory
make[1]: *** No rule to make target '/mylocalpath/feeds/packages/lang/python/python3-package.mk'.  Stop.

The relative path is used already in 19.07 for most of the packages, and
has been updated for the packages at hand in master as well:

302f4d17e3 ("libmraa,libupm: Disable default Python package build recipe")
1bc2f4f3c6 ("treewide: Remove Python variants for non-Python packages")

Eneas U de Queiroz e7408d94c5 libmraa: don't set SWIG_DIR
CMake 3.0.12 uses SWIG_DIR to set SWIG_LIB, is used as the library
install location, which defaults to
$(STAGING_HOSTPKG)/share/sig/(SWIGVERSION).  If it is set, then the
installed swig library directory is ignored, and compilation fails:
[ 32%] Swig source
:1: Error: Unable to find 'swig.swg'
:3: Error: Unable to find 'python.swg'

Instead of setting it manually, let the default be used, which works
well.
